The binding supports series 7 and series 8 controllers with some limitations. From the readme:
Note: As of OpenHAB 4.1 Controllers based on Silabs SDK 7 are partially supported. For SDK 7 controllers “Classic” inclusion (node numbers 1-232) is supported, but the higher power Long Range inclusion (node numbers over 255) is not.
I’m told the same is true for series 8 controllers.
